Atrium Health Levine Children’s Advocacy Centers (CAC) are places that advocate for abused children in our community. With a team of RN’s, Medical Providers, a victim advocates, forensic interviewers and office personnel, the CAC team works closely with law enforcement, mental health, the District Attorney’s office, and Child Protective Services to make sure abused children in our community have a voice.

About Advocate Health

Advocate Health [https://www.advocatehealth.org/] is the third-largest nonprofit, integrated health system in the United States, created from the combination of Advocate Aurora Health and Atrium Health.

Providing care under the names Advocate Health Care [https://www.advocatehealth.com/] in Illinois; Atrium Health [https://atriumhealth.org/] in the Carolinas, Georgia and Alabama; and Aurora Health Care [https://www.aurorahealthcare.org/] in Wisconsin, Advocate Health is a national leader in clinical innovation, health outcomes, consumer experience and value-based care.

Head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ina, Advocate Health services nearly 6 million patients and is engaged in hundreds of clinical trials and research studies, with Wake Forest University School of Medicine [https://school.wakehealth.edu/] serving as the academic core of the enterprise.

It is nationally recognized for its expertise in cardiology, neurosciences, oncology, pediatrics and rehabilitation, as well as organ transplants, burn treatments and specialized musculoskeletal programs.

Advocate Health employs 155,000 teammates across 69 hospitals and over 1,000 care locations, and offers one of the nation’s largest graduate medical education programs with over 2,000 residents and fellows across more than 200 programs.

Committed to providing equitable care for all, Advocate Health provides more than $6 billion in annual community benefits.

Market context

Advanced practice roles in North Carolina

Advanced-practice roles in North Carolina often show steady demand in hospitals, clinics, and specialty practices, especially for candidates who can work autonomously and meet licensure and certification requirements. These positions can be competitive because employers often look for a graduate nursing degree, 2–4 years of relevant experience, and current NC licensure, DEA, and BLS credentials.
